Regional patients struggle to access mental health teleservices

Regional patients struggle to access mental health teleservices

Rural and regional people say a recent Medicare change is affecting access to mental health treatment. The change, implemented in November, means patients will need to see a GP face-to-face first to access treatment via video consultation.
